WebMar 7, 2024 · At the emergency custody hearing, the judge will review the evidence and make a decision regarding custody. If the judge decides to change custody, he or she will issue a temporary order of custody. This could mean that one parent will have full custody of the child for a period of time. Emergency custody is when a judge steps in to make a ruling on who should have custody of a child in a situation that requires immediate action to maintain the safety and well-being of a child. WebMaria A. on behalf of Leslie G. v. Oscar G., 301 Neb. 673, 919 N.W.2d 841 (2024). Whether domestic abuse occurred is a threshold issue in determining whether an ex parte protection order should be affirmed; absent abuse as defined by the Protection from Domestic Abuse Act, a protection order may not remain in effect. WebSection 71-1119 Emergency custody; application; court order; evaluation by department. (1) The petitioner may apply to the court to have the subject taken into emergency custody and held pending a hearing on the petition and disposition pursuant to sections 71-1122 to 71-1126.
